Collecting and Analyzing Data: The Foundation of Sports Analytics

The first step in using sports analytics for developing personalized training programs is data collection. This involves tracking numerous aspects of an athlete’s performance, such as speed, agility, and strength, as well as physiological parameters like heart rate and oxygen consumption. These data points can be gathered through various means such as wearable devices, video analysis, and physical testing.

Once collected, the data needs to be analyzed and interpreted. This task can be complex, given the sheer amount of information and the need for precise interpretations. Thankfully, the advent of advanced software and algorithms has made it possible to sift through mountains of data and extract meaningful insights with relative ease.

These insights can provide a comprehensive view of an athlete’s performance, helping to identify areas of strength and weakness. In turn, this information can be used to design a training program that focuses on improving weaknesses and capitalizing on strengths.

Personalizing Training Programs with Sports Analytics

Sports analytics has revolutionized the way training programs are developed. Traditionally, most training programs were based on a ‘one-size-fits-all’ approach. However, sports analytics has ushered in the era of personalized training, where each program is tailor-made to suit an athlete’s specific needs.

To develop a personalized training program, the insights derived from sports analytics are used to identify the areas that need improvement. This could be anything from increasing agility and quickness to improving endurance or strength. The training program is then customized to target these areas.

For instance, if the data indicates that an athlete lacks endurance, the personalized training program might include more cardiovascular exercises and longer training sessions. Alternatively, if the athlete shows a lack of strength, the program might focus on weightlifting and resistance training.

Enhancing Performance and Reducing Injury Risk

The benefits of using sports analytics for developing personalized training programs extend beyond improving performance. By providing detailed insights into an athlete’s physiology and biomechanics, sports analytics can play a vital role in injury prevention as well.

Sports injuries often result from overuse, poor training methods, or underlying weaknesses that go unnoticed. By analyzing data, coaches and athletes can identify these potential risk factors and adjust the training program accordingly. This preventative approach can significantly reduce the likelihood of injuries, allowing athletes to maintain peak performance levels for longer periods.

For example, if data analysis reveals that an athlete is putting undue strain on certain muscle groups during training, modifications can be made to the training program to alleviate this stress. This could involve altering the training intensity, incorporating recovery periods, or introducing exercises to strengthen the affected muscles.

Integrating Sports Analytics into Your Training Regime

Integrating sports analytics into your training regime does not have to be a daunting task. Start by identifying what data would be most beneficial for your training needs. This could range from simple metrics like distance and speed to more complex data such as VO2 max or lactate threshold.

Next, choose suitable methods and tools for data collection. This may include wearable technology, video analysis software, or professional testing services. Once you have collected the data, use an appropriate analysis tool to interpret and derive insights from it.

By integrating sports analytics into your training regime, you can gain a holistic understanding of your performance, identify areas for improvement, and tailor your training program to meet these needs. This targeted approach can result in significant performance improvements and a reduced risk of injury.

Case Studies of Sports Analytics Success

Various individuals and teams worldwide have successfully incorporated sports analytics into their training programs. These case studies offer valuable insights into the practical application of sports analytics and its potential benefits.

One such example is the use of sports analytics by the British Cycling team. They have used data analysis to gain a competitive edge for years, collecting and analyzing performance data to optimize each rider’s training program. This strategy led to unprecedented success in the 2012 and 2016 Olympic Games where they won a total of 16 gold medals.

In the world of football, clubs like Liverpool FC have integrated sports analytics into their operations, using it to assess player performance and to guide their transfer strategy. This data-driven approach is one of the key factors behind their domestic and international success in recent years.

In the realm of individual sports, tennis greats like Novak Djokovic and Serena Williams have been known to use sports analytics to enhance their performance. They use detailed match data to understand their opponents’ strategies and to adapt their game plan accordingly. This has played a large part in their sustained success at the highest level.

These examples demonstrate the transformative power of sports analytics. It’s not a magic potion for instant success but rather a tool that, if wielded correctly, can lead to significant improvements in performance.
